upgrade your fronts, if you really want great sounding system then go active, that with some DIYMA speakers (brands like dayton, scanspeak, seas for example) and a sub in the rear will kill pretty much everything out there as far as sound quality goes and youd save a ton of money, just some food for thought. if you want to go passive (most common 2 and 3 way setup that comes with a crossover) then id go with something like focals K2P, or pioneer 720prs i believe is the model that gets rave reviews. DLS iridiums are also badass. there is more out there but those are a few that comes to mind

but like i said, its just some food for thought- id rip out and leave out the rear speakers, get a nice set of fronts and a single sub would do perfectly

I'm in complete agreement with those who are saying to forget about the rear speakers for your listening pleasure as a driver. Think about it this way....when you go to a live show....Is the music in front of you or behind you? (or even in your living room for that matter) If the music in the rear is for the kids or whatever, do you think they will be impressed or care that you upgraded the sound? Good sound is about image or imaging, if you prefer. Just look at all the custom A-pillar tweeter installs.....great imaging. Regarding preference, let your ears tell you what is good, not anyone else. Quality is good, but I've heard a lot of shi**y sounding expensive speakers. When buying it's always good to hear what a speaker sounds like in a car, not on a display rack. Ask the owner of whatever audio shop what he has in his car and if you can listen to his system.

I wouldn't worry about over-amping speakers. I would worry more about under-amping them. You prolly won't be pushing them to the limit anyway. Over-amping assures that you will be delivering clean sound at all volumes. If you aren't sold on this yet, just adjust the output on the amp. By a speaker because it sounds good, not for anyother reason (IMHO). Regarding the ratings on a sub being the same as on front separates, if that is what you meant here..........huh? why?
